Ukraine's Health Ministry comments on US Director of National Intelligence's claims about "US biolabs" in Ukraine
Ukraine's Health Ministry has commented on claims by US Director of National Intelligence Tulsi Gabbard that the US government has long funded more than 120 "biolaboratories", including in Ukraine.
Source: Ukraine's Health Ministry in a comment, as reported by European Pravda
Details: The Ukrainian ministry said Ukraine has consistently fulfilled its international obligations under the Biological and Toxin Weapons Convention (BTWC) and has never engaged in the development, production or stockpiling of biological weapons.
The ministry said cooperation between Ukraine and the United States in the field of biosafety over many years has been aimed exclusively at strengthening public health system capacity, epidemiological surveillance, laboratory diagnostics, biosafety and biosecurity.
It clarified that this refers to activities that comply with international public health standards and practices and are exclusively civilian in nature.
Laboratory institutions that participated in relevant international technical assistance programmes are diagnostic, scientific or reference laboratories within the public health system, veterinary medicine or other research institutions.
"By their very nature, they are neither designed nor capable of being used for the development of biological weapons or for conducting research aimed at creating pathogens with enhanced dangerous properties," the Ministry of Health stressed.
Ukraine's Health Ministry said the presence of pathogen samples in laboratories is not unusual. Such samples are used worldwide for diagnostics, epidemiological surveillance, scientific research and responding to outbreaks of infectious diseases.
Quote: "Ukraine remains committed to the principles of transparency, international cooperation, and strengthening the global biosafety framework. We believe it is important to rely on the results of international consultations that have already taken place and on verified facts, rather than on assumptions or interpretations of certain aspects of international technical assistance programmes."
Background:
- Tulsi Gabbard earlier "declassified" materials that allegedly contain evidence of long-term US government funding for more than 120 "biolaboratories", including some in Ukraine.
- Her press release claims that the biolabs – where research is conducted into biological pathogens, including dangerous ones – include laboratories in Ukraine which may be "at risk of compromise due to the ongoing Russia-Ukraine war".
- On the accompanying "map", Gabbard's office has marked the location of Kyiv or Kyiv Oblast incorrectly and labelled one of the sites "Cherniv". The "map" also indicates that Ukraine supposedly has "biolaboratories" in Russian-occupied Crimea and in a city called "Zakarpattia".
- In response, the Ukrainian Foreign Ministry has rejected these baseless allegations.
